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A retelling of Pride and Prejudice and Emma, bringing some of your favorite couples together in unexpected ways! When Lizzy Bennet spends a winter visit in Highbury with her father's cousins, Miss Jane Fairfax and Mrs. Bates, she becomes friends with the young lady of Hartfield, Emma Woodhouse. At least, everyone assumes they will be friends, but soon Lizzy is as invested in Harriet Smith's sweet romance as Emma is opposed to it, and neither of these spirited heroines will back down easily! And when Darcy visits his friend George Knightley, it's a complete carousel of mistaken affections and awkward confrontations. Some in the neighborhood are convinced Mr. Darcy remains in town for Emma. Some think Lizzy would be an excellent young bride for Mr. Knightley. Meanwhile Lizzy accidentally discovers love letters to Jane Fairfax, Lady Catherine hears rumors of Darcy's courtship of Emma, and Mr. Knightley rescues the wrong girl at the ball. Between Christmas parties, outdoor frescoes, and fireside chats, the Highbury community is in for all the drama their village can hold.
